Cameron Village, Baltimore, MD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cameron Village?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cameron Village Studio Apartments | $1,277 | $995 | $2,604 |
| Cameron Village 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,613 | $550 | $5,375 |
Cameron Village 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,761 | $1,050 | $4,003 |
| Cameron Village 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,114 | $1,089 | $4,725 |
| Cameron Village 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,550 | $700 | $2,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Cameron Village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Cameron Village with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Cameron Village is at Yorkewood Apartments listed at $1,000.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Cameron Village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Cameron Village is $1,761.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Cameron Village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Cameron Village is a 1,680 square feet unit starting from $1,705 at Broadview Apartments.
What is the average size for Cameron Village 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Cameron Village is currently 1,111 sq ft.
